@kyleigh_runte
Для подключения к базе данных MySQL в Python скрипте можно использовать модуль mysql.connector
.
Вот простой пример подключения к бд: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 |
import mysql.connector # Установка параметров подключения config = { 'user': 'username', 'password': 'password', 'host': 'localhost', 'database': 'database_name', 'raise_on_warnings': True } # Подключение к базе данных conn = mysql.connector.connect(**config) # Создание объекта cursor cursor = conn.cursor() # Выполнение SQL-запроса cursor.execute("SELECT * FROM table_name") # Получение результата запроса result = cursor.fetchall() # Вывод результата for row in result: print(row) # Закрытие соединения и курсора cursor.close() conn.close() |
Убедитесь, что у вас уже установлен модуль mysql.connector
, который можно установить с помощью команды pip install mysql-connector-python
. Замените username
, password
, localhost
, database_name
и table_name
на соответствующие значения вашей базы данных.
@kyleigh_runte
Также стоит добавить, что перед использованием данного кода, необходимо убедиться, что MySQL сервер запущен и доступен для соединения, а также пользователя, указанного в параметрах подключения, имеет права на доступ к указанной базе данных и таблице.
@kyleigh_runte
Да, спасибо за дополнение. Важно также учитывать наличие необходимых привилегий у пользователя для работы с базой данных, чтобы избежать проблем при выполнении запросов. Без правильной конфигурации доступа к базе данных скрипт может не работать корректно.